- “Nourished on the blood of a schizophrenic, a spider waves crazy webs.” —Guido Ceronetti, The Silence of the Body. |
- During the 1950s, a Swiss pharmacologist named Peter Witt conducted a set of experiments in spider doping. He found that the spiders spun uniquely cockeyed webs depending on which substance they had ingested. [SOURCE]
Images: ‘Normal’, Caffeine, LSD, Mescaline, in clockwise order.
